    I know there are many reviewers out there that like to use a phone for a little bit of time before they give their thoughts and I think that is necessary too when doing a full review of a new device. However, initial impressions are just as important because that time period is when you notice any big differences on your new device that may be different from your old device. I am coming from a BlackBerry DTEK60.

    I'll try to keep this as short as I can. I'm sure you've all read/watched reviews on the keyboard. It is fantastic. There is not much more to be said about the keyboard. It gives great feedback unlike the priv, it does not feel small, (I have large hands), and it just works REALLY well. I really have no complaints whatsoever.

    Build quality is absolutely fantastic as well. This thing feels like a 20 pound dumbbell compared to my DTEK60 and that's a good thing in my opinion. No PRIV-like creaking, and no DTEK60-like slip. I will not be using a case on this phone. Fingerprint sensor is quick and snappy.

    Software runs smooth and fluid, faster than my DTEK60. Too early to comment on battery life but I think that has been a general consensus amongst users that it is fantastic. The camera is very good but there are better options out there. So if you're looking for a fantastic mobile camera then you might want to go down the Pixel, S8, or even S7 road. The camera is very capable but not the best. (Thanks captain obvious, I know).

    The display is good but not great as you may know. Historically I have preferred AMOLED displays over LCD. This display gets the job done for sure, but you will notice it lacking when you pull up the odd youtube video here and there. (Again this is relative to my DTEK60 as that is what I'm switching from)

    NEGATIVES

    Here's what I've noticed right away that I do not like. Decide for yourself whether this is important to you or not, but these are things that are very noticeable for me. The vibration on this phone is..not very good. At all. It sounds terrible, it feels terrible. There's not much more to be said. Now this could be completely just my device only, but this is certainly been noticeable. It is not very good.

    Next is those capacitive buttons. I read about some folks having to press them multiple times before registering. This is totally true from my experience and by far my biggest negative with the KEYone. The full virtual buttons on the DTEK60 were much quicker and worked much better.

    It's been a day, so I'll certainly share more of my experience as I get used to this device more. I would have liked to have gotten a factory unlocked unit for future updates going forward but unfortunately that didn't happen. (Canada). I am overall very satisfied, this is an upgrade to my DTEK60, no matter what the spec sheet says. Enjoy your KEYones folks, and for those of you that are frustrated with how things have gone, you will not find another device like this. Do not settle for anything less. I understand your frustration but if you truly want this device then wait it out, you will be happy in the end. Cheers to another 12 months of another new BlackBerry!! Happy typing everyone.
